Making a Call with Speed Dial
When the phone is in standby, press and hold the number key ([0] - [9]) until the assigned phonebook entry
appears in the display.
Press
[ /ash] or [ ] on the handset to dial the number.

Switching to the Handset Speakerphone During a Call
To switch a normal call to the speakerphone, press [ ] on the handset. To switch from a speaker phone call to a
normal call, press
[ ].
